Biography

Career Accolades

  • Tied for eighth in program history in career points (43) 
  • Fourth in program history in career goals (26) 

As a senior (2021-22) (Game-by-Game Statistics):

  • Played in 24 games 
  • MAC Offensive Player of the Week (2/7/22) 
  • Posted 17 points on nine goals and eight assists 
  • Earned a +9 rating 
  • Recorded four contests with multiple points 
  • Cashed in on a goal and assist against third-ranked Utica (11/13/21) 
  • Had an assist in consecutive contests against Tufts (11/26/21, 11/27/21) 
  • Posted a three-game goal scoring streak, tallying four total markers
  • Logged two goals at Neumann (2/4/22)

As a junior (2020-21) (Game-by-Game Statistics)

  • Made 16 appearances with two starts
  • Notched 10 points on seven goals and three assists
  • Posted a +3 rating and two game-winning goals
  • Scored a pair of empty net goals
  • Found the back of the net twice at Neumann (3/13/21)

As a sophomore (2019-20) (Game-by-game statistics):

  • Appeared in all 28 games for the Mustangs at forward
  • Recorded 11 points on eight goals and three assists
  • Netted one power play, shorthanded, and game-winning goal
  • Scored twice in a victory at Morrisville (11/17)
  • Totaled four points on one goal and three assists in a win over Chatham (1/4)
  • Finished with 14 blocked shots, 73 shots on net, and a +4 rating

As a freshman (2018-19) (Game-by-Game Statistics):

  • Appeared in 23 of the team’s 25 games at forward
  • Made his collegiate debut in a victory over Morrisville (10/27)
  • Recorded five points on two goals and three assists
  • Netted one power play goal and one game-winning goal
  • Dished out two assists in a win over King’s (11/10)
  • Scored his first career goal versus Nazareth (12/1)
